Glucose is a form of sugar found in the blood. Cells use glucose as a source of energy, but too much or too little can cause ser

ious health issues. So, the body uses the hormone insulin to regulate glucose in the blood. Insulin helps maintain glucose levels in the blood. If blood glucose levels got very high, what would you expect to see happen to insulin levels?
